Window Sticker
A PDF of a window sticker is available for VIN KM8J33A2XJU646407.
Also called Monroney label, it's a label required in the United States to be displayed in all new automobiles.
It may include certain official information about the car such as:
-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P)
- Engine and Transmission Specifications
- Equipment, Packages, and Extra Features
- Fuel Economy Rating
- Other Information

Frequently asked questions
Discrepancies between a window sticker and actual dealer pricing can occur due to additional dealer markup, optional add-ons not included in the sticker, or regional pricing differences.
Recall information may reveal if the vehicle has had any manufacturer defects that needed correction, impacting its safety and market value, depending on the completeness of recall data.
Gray market status, if noted, indicates the 2018 HYUNDAI was imported outside official channels, potentially affecting its compliance with local regulations and parts availability.
A potential buyer can use a VIN decoder to verify the features of a used car by confirming the model, trim level, and installed options, ensuring the features match those advertised.
VIN decoding can prevent fraud in the sale of 2018 HYUNDAI TUCSON vehicles by ensuring the vehicle's details match those recorded officially, thus confirming its identity and legality.
Registration information, if available, includes current and historical registration data, offering insights into the 2018 HYUNDAI TUCSON's ownership timeline.
Yes, the Monroney label includes information about the vehicle’s manufacturing origin, specifying where the vehicle was assembled and the origin of its parts.
